Anambra billionaire, Arthur Eze, backs Soludo’s second term bid

Prominent oil magnate and philanthropist, Chief Arthur Eze, has declared his full support for Governor Chukwuma Charles Soludo’s bid for a second term as the Governor of Anambra State, describing the incumbent as a visionary leader ordained by God.

Speaking at a recent event, Chief Eze praised Soludo’s leadership over the past three years, emphasizing that his administration has brought transformative progress to Anambra.

“No individual or group can defeat Governor Soludo in the upcoming election; he is ordained by God to continue leading Anambra to greatness,” he said.

Eze appealed to the people of Anambra to unite behind the governor to ensure the continued development of the state. “Soludo has character. His name, ‘Chukwuma,’ means ‘God knows His plan,’ which aligns perfectly with his purpose and actions,” he noted.

Responding to critics of the governor’s re-election bid, Eze dismissed opposition candidates as lacking both credibility and vision. He maintained that attempts to unseat Soludo would fail, reinforcing his unwavering belief in the governor’s leadership.

In his remarks, Governor Soludo reiterated his administration’s commitment to the advancement of Anambra.

“Anambra has all it takes to be a great state. There is nothing we envision for Anambra that we cannot achieve,” he said, highlighting the state’s abundant human and natural resources.

Eze’s endorsement is seen as a major boost for Soludo’s 2025 re-election campaign. As a respected figure with significant influence, his support is expected to strengthen the governor’s chances amid a dynamic political landscape.
